RapidSOS is for agencies and enterprises needing AI-enhanced emergency response infrastructure; Trio is a lightweight translation tool for phone calls. They don't compete directly. Choose RapidSOS if you run a 911 center or enterprise safety program. Choose Trio if you need real-time interpretation without apps. Both serve very different needs.

Who should pick which

  • 911 Center Director
    Pick: RapidSOS

    RapidSOS provides AI dispatch support, live video, drone integration, and real-time data from connected devices—directly enhancing 911 operations.

  • Small Healthcare Clinic
    Pick: Trio

    Trio offers real-time phone interpretation for limited-English patients without apps, with HIPAA BAA available on Enterprise plan.

  • Ride-Share Fleet Manager
    Pick: RapidSOS

    RapidSOS integrates crash alerts and emergency detection via API/SDK, connecting fleets directly to 911.

  • Real Estate Agent Handling International Clients
    Pick: Trio

    Trio supports 5 languages including Mandarin and Spanish, with industry-specific terminology, no app needed—ideal for property calls.

  • School Safety Administrator
    Pick: RapidSOS

    RapidSOS provides emergency escalation and data integration for school campuses, connecting with local 911.

Can Trio translate text or video?

No, Trio is exclusively for real-time phone call translation. It does not support text or video calls.

Does RapidSOS offer any free tier?

No, RapidSOS uses contact-based pricing. It is designed for agencies and enterprises, not individual consumers.

Which languages does Trio support?

5 premium languages: Mandarin Chinese, Spanish, Portuguese, Korean, and Japanese. Industry-specific terminology is available for real estate, banking, and legal.

Does RapidSOS include translation?

Yes, via HARMONY AI, which now runs on AT&T ESInet. It handles text/video transcription and translation for 911 calls.

Can I use Trio without internet?

Yes, Trio works on any phone (landline, mobile, office system) without internet or app download.

Who is RapidSOS not for?

Individual consumers, small businesses on a tight budget, and regions without public safety adoption of RapidSOS.

Can Trio be used for conference calls?

Yes, Trio supports 3-way conference calls with translation.

Does RapidSOS integrate with drones?

Yes, it has Drone as First Responder (DFR) integration, allowing live video from drones to 911.
